How does working from home affect communication?
More than eight out of ten (83 percent) remote workers felt overwhelmed by email, as teams fail to capitalise on alternative technologies, such as video or audio conferencing, to enable regular collective communications. In some cases, this lack of interaction leads team members to feel isolated.

How to deal with competitive coworkers at work?
But that doesn’t always happen. Competitive coworkers may be insecure leading them to feel threatened by your success. Try to show this person that you want to work with them, not against them. Collaborate with them, but make sure to leave a paper, or carbon copy, trail indicating that you worked on projects.
How to have a face to face conversation with a coworker?
When you are having a face-to-face discussion with a coworker, pay attention to any nonverbal messages. For example, if your coworker’s arms are relaxed and open, they are ready to listen. If your coworker is making eye contact, they are ready to focus and hear what you have to say.
